Hemlock Lake
Hemlock Lake is a public boat ramp on Hemlock Lake near Glen Campbell, Pennsylvania.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, canoeing, paddleboarding. Amenities include boat ramp, parking. Best visited in spring and summer and fall.

About This Location
Lake access at Hemlock Lake near Glen Campbell, Pennsylvania. Good for kayaking and canoeing.
Situated on Hemlock Lake in Pennsylvania, Hemlock Lake is a launch point for kayakers, canoeists, and SUP enthusiasts.
Kayaking is the most popular activity here, with the water conditions supporting a range of skill levels. Canoeists can enjoy the calmer sections for a relaxed paddle.
You can expect calm and sheltered water when paddling here. The recommended season runs March through November. Facilities include boat ramp and parking.
Located about 5 min from Glen Campbell, Hemlock Lake is a convenient option for Glen Campbell-area paddlers.
